I have nightmares thinking of the quick no-huddle teams we'll face this year, and how DeVito and Jackson won't be able to get off the field for a sub-out. Unless Poe learns how to breach through the hull, we'll be getting precisely zero pressure from our 3 linemen, which has been the case ever since we switched to the 3-4.
Richardson would probably be the solution to that problem. Leave him on the field. Might get gashed once or twice, but at least QBs aren't going to have all day to throw if we don't want to send an extra guy like DJ or Berry on a blitz. |

Personally, the Baylor film is intriguing to me. My philosophy on stopping the ZR is a combo of both 2 and 1 gap principles on your front, (see Pittsburgh v. Redskins) Effectively, you'd have one player who got upfield quickly, which would either A) Blow up the lead or IZ play, or B) Force the QB to take it himself. However, by keeping your DEs in 2-gap principles, you have an advantage. Additionally, you can create more confusion, such as utilizing this out of 5DB packages and running an IDB blitz.

I think Poe will provide some pass rush from the NT position this year. With the change to a more attacking style defense, his initial quickness should be an asset. Plus he has a year of experience in the league.
Richardson would provide some pass rush from the 3 tech, but would teams decide to run at him since stopping the run isn't his strong suit? IMO, Star could play either the 3 or 5 tech and provide some pass rush while not being a liability vs. the run. He's not the pass rusher that Richardson is, but I think he's the more complete player. |

The ability to play multiple techniques is exactly why Poe was drafted and DeVito was signed. Don't think of DeVito as a DE and OLB. He can play the five technique and also play more of a 4-3 tackle or the nose. Poe isn't there but the talent is. He wasn't bad in the nose next year and he has tremendous ability to play the five tech too. Will he develop into that? Yet tobe seen. It's why I never understood the hate for the Poe pick. If he develops as planned, he is exactly the kind of player you need to beat the no huddle. To the point of the thread, this pick would be fine with me. DeVito is a nice to have, but he can be upgraded and depth is never a bad thing at that position. |
